The Myth of the Work/Life Balance for Small Library Directors
This webinar explores how to find balance between your personal and professional life, in service of yourself and your community.
This event has passed.
Being the director of a small library means that you often can, and do, do it all! It can be a challenge to find the balance between your personal and professional life, but organization, planning and creativity can all help make time for what’s important to you. But so can flexing the muscles that allow us to let go of what we can’t control, manage expectations (including our own), and appreciate that ‘less than perfect’ can be the secret to a balanced life. Join us to explore ideas to better delegate, cross train, and collaborate, and how to live with a job done well-enough, in service of yourself and your community.
Presented by: Cindy Fesemyer, Principal and Founder, Fesemyer Consulting, LLC, teaches for UW-Madison iSchool Continuing Education, and Trustee for the Madison Public Library (WI)
